Title: Expression of Survivin and cyclooxygenase-2 and their relationship in cervical carcinoma
Abstract: Objective To investigate the Survivin and Cyclooxygenase-2 (COX-2) expression and their relationship in cervical carcinoma tissues and to investigate the relationship with the genesis and devclopment of cervical carcinoma.Methods The expression of Survivin and COX-2 was assayed by immunohistochemical technique in 60 cervical carcinoma and 30 normal cervical tissue specimens.The relation with its clinical pathology characters were analysed.Results Survivin and COX-2 expression in the tissues of cervical carcinoma [76.7 % (46/60),63.3 % (38/60)] were higher than that in normal cervical tissues evidently [6.7 % (2/30),10.0 % (3/30)] (P < 0.05).The COX-2 expression in cervical carcinoma was positively associated with lymph node metastasis (P < 0.05),but no correlation was found between COX-2 expression and age,clinical stages,grades and invasive depth (P > 0.05).Any correlation between Survivin expression and classical prognostic factors of cervical carcinoma was found.Moreover,these two proteins were positively correlated.Conclusion The Survivin and COX-2 might play important roles in the development of cervical carcinoma.
